    Hello guys!
    We will have a MDSAP audit soon.

    During the recent ISO 13485 audit, our auditor pointed out that we should comply with Brazilian biosafty regulations that require to attach biosafety identifiers in our lab.

    Then, I check up on Brazilian GMP regulation.

    It stipulates below requirement:

    5.1.3.6 Biological safety standards shall be observed in the cases where there is biological risk.

    Is it a specific Brazilian standard or other international recognized standard?
